According to PayPal:
Here's how you can confirm your shipping address:
Add a credit card to your PayPal account. By adding a credit card to your account, PayPal can attempt to confirm your address with your credit card company. If the credit card company is not able to confirm your address, you may be asked to complete the Expanded Use enrollment process to activate your credit card. Your address can be confirmed after that process is complete. Note: Not all credit card companies are able to confirm addresses.
Apply for PayPal Buyer Credit (https://www.paypal.com/us/buyercredit). If approved, the address on your application will be a confirmed address.
Complete Alternate Address Confirmation. This process takes several days and is only available for U.S. accounts. To learn more, log in to your PayPal account and visit the Alternate Address Confirmation page (https://www.paypal.com/us/cgi-bin/webscr?cmd=_account-aac).I've never heard of a 30-day waiting period before.
